On a somber morning in western Alaska, a charter plane tragically crashed, claiming the lives of all eight passengers and crew members onboard. The aircraft went down in proximity to a remote radar site, a location known for its challenging conditions and difficult accessibility. This incident not only brings sorrow to the families of the victims but also raises critical questions about aviation safety in remote regions.
The charter flight, which was reportedly on a routine journey, encountered catastrophic failure leading to the crash. Emergency services, while quick to respond, faced extreme difficulties due to the remote nature of the site. In the wake of the disaster, federal authorities have initiated an investigation to determine the cause of the crash. The National Transportation Safety Board (NTSB) has been deployed to gather data and analyze flight records. This thorough investigation will include a review of weather conditions, maintenance logs, and pilot qualifications, aiming to uncover what led to this tragic event.
